In the realm of audio technology, the debate between wireless and wired microphones is a topic that continues to intrigue both professionals and enthusiasts. This comparison isn't merely about preference; it involves weighing the tangible benefits and potential drawbacks of each type. As technology continues to advance, understanding these differences is crucial for making informed decisions based on specific needs.
Wireless microphones, such as the Alpowl wireless microphone, have gained popularity due to their convenience and flexibility. Without the tether of a cable, performers and speakers can move freely, which is particularly advantageous in dynamic settings like stage performances, conferences, and fitness instruction. However, this freedom comes at a cost, primarily in terms of reliability and battery management.
Wired microphones, on the other hand, are renowned for their reliability. The direct connection ensures consistent sound quality without the risk of interference from other wireless devices. However, they bring their own set of challenges, such as mobility restrictions and the potential for physical damage to cables.
When discussing reliability, wired microphones often take the lead. The direct connection to sound equipment means there is minimal risk of signal dropouts or interference, which can be critical in professional audio settings. This reliability is why wired microphones remain a staple in recording studios and broadcast environments.
Conversely, wireless microphones require careful management of batteries to maintain consistent performance. The risk of a battery running out mid-performance is a legitimate concern, necessitating regular checks and backups. Moreover, wireless microphones can be susceptible to signal interference from other wireless devices, which might disrupt a seamless performance.
The most significant advantage of wireless microphones is undoubtedly the freedom they provide. Whether using a microphone headset wireless for a fitness class or wireless earbuds with microphone for a virtual meeting, the absence of cables means users can move freely without entanglement or tripping hazards. This mobility is particularly beneficial in large venues or outdoor events where cable length would otherwise limit movement.
Additionally, advancements in wireless technology have significantly improved sound quality, narrowing the gap between wired and wireless options. Modern wireless microphones often feature sophisticated encryption and frequency-hopping technologies that help minimize interference and ensure a stable connection.
Sound quality remains a critical factor in the microphone debate. Wired microphones traditionally offer superior sound fidelity, making them the preferred choice for audiophiles and sound engineers who require the utmost clarity and detail. The lack of wireless transmission means there is no compression or potential loss of audio data, which can occur with wireless systems.
However, the gap in sound quality is closing as wireless technology advances. High-end wireless microphones now offer exceptional sound quality that rivals their wired counterparts, thanks to improvements in audio codecs and transmission technologies. Brands like Alpowl have embraced these innovations, ensuring that their wireless microphones deliver high-quality sound suitable for various applications.
When it comes to durability, both wired and wireless microphones have their strengths and weaknesses. Wired microphones are physically robust, but the cables can be susceptible to wear and tear, such as fraying, tangling, or damage from being stepped on.
Wireless microphones eliminate the cable issue entirely, but they introduce the need for battery maintenance. Regular battery checks and replacements are necessary to prevent unexpected outages during use. Additionally, wireless systems require careful frequency management to avoid interference, especially in environments with multiple wireless devices.
The decision between a wired and wireless microphone ultimately depends on the specific needs and priorities of the user. For stationary applications where reliability is paramount, such as studio recording or broadcasting, a wired microphone may be the best choice. However, for scenarios demanding mobility, such as live performances, lectures, or athletic coaching, a wireless microphone offers unmatched convenience and freedom.
